Nabil Khachab (born 9 September 2000) is a Moroccan-Dutch kickboxer, currently competing in the heavyweight division of Glory. As of October 2024, he is ranked as the sixth best heavyweight kickboxer in the world by Beyond Kickboxing.

Kickboxing career

Khachab made his Glory debut against Uku Jürjendal at Glory 83 on February 11, 2023. He won the fight by unanimous decision.

Khachab faced Sofian Laidouni at Glory 84 on March 11, 2023. He lost the fight by unanimous decision.

Khachab faced Nikola Filipović in a Glory Heavyweight tournament qualifier at Glory 90 on December 23, 2023. He won the fight by unanimous decision.

Khachab took part in the Glory Heavyweight Grand Prix, held on March 9, 2024. Despite overcoming the two-time Glory Heavyweight title challenger Benjamin Adegbuyi by unanimous decision in the tournament quarterfinals, he was himself eliminated by unanimous decision by the eventual tournament winner Rico Verhoeven in the semifinals.

Khachab faced Buğra Erdoğan at Glory 96 on October 12, 2024, winning via unanimous decision.

Khachab took part in the Glory 99 “Heavyweight Last Man Standing Tournament” where 32 heavyweight fighters competed on April 5, 2025 in Rotterdam, Netherlands. He faced Miloš Cvjetićanin, losing via split decision.

Khachab faced Nathan Cook at Glory 103, winning via unanimous decision. In the process, he scored his first, and to date only, two knockdowns of his Glory career in round 2.

Khachab faced Sofian Laidouni at Glory 104, on October 11, 2025. He lost the fight via unanimous decision.
